Aviva (LON:AV) Insider Acquires £1,491 in Stock

Aviva plc (LON:AVGet Free Report) insider Pippa Lambert bought 210 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ction dated Tuesday, September 15th. The shares were acquired at an average cost of GBX 710 per share, for a total transaction of £1,491.

Pippa Lambert also recently made the following trade(s):

  • On Monday, August 17th, Pippa Lambert acquired 205 shares of Aviva stock. The shares were bought at an average price of GBX 729 per share, with a total value of £1,494.45.
  • On Wednesday, July 15th, Pippa Lambert purchased 226 shares of Aviva stock. The stock was bought at an average cost of GBX 662 per share, with a total value of £1,496.12.

Wall Street Analysts Forecast Growth

Several research analysts have issued reports on AV shares. Citigroup increased their price objective on Aviva from GBX 671 to GBX 721 and gave the stock a “neutral” rating in a research report on Wednesday, August 26th. JPMorgan Chase & Co. upped their target price on Aviva from GBX 715 to GBX 800 and gave the company an “overweight” rating in a research note on Thursday, August 13th. Royal Bank Of Canada reiterated an “outperform” rating and set a GBX 780 target price on shares of Aviva in a report on Monday, September 7th. Finally, Berenberg Bank boosted their price target on Aviva from GBX 800 to GBX 820 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a report on Monday, August 17th. Five research anal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, two have issued a Hold rating and one has assigned a Sell r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at.com, the company currently has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average target price of GBX 739.75.

Aviva Company Profile

Aviva plc provides various insurance, retirement, investment, and savings products in the United Kingdom, Ireland, Canada, and internationally. The company offers life insurance, long-term health and accident insurance, savings, pension, and annuity products, as well as pension fund business and lifetime mortgage products. It also provides insurance cover to individuals, small and medium-sized businesses for risks associated with motor vehicles and medical expenses, as well as property and liability, such as employers' and professional indemnity liabilities.
